Optimised tokenizer/lexer generator! π Uses /y for performance. Moo.
β874Feb 27, 2026Updated 3 weeks ago
Alternatives and similar repositories for moo
Users that are interested in moo are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- πππ² Simple, fast, powerful parser toolkit for JavaScript.β3,739Nov 14, 2024Updated last year
- Parser Building Toolkit for JavaScriptβ2,759Updated this week
- JS parser generator. As fast as yacc, but accepts any grammar!β15Mar 22, 2017Updated 9 years ago
- The Language Nobody Could Come Up With A Good Name Forβ19Jun 12, 2016Updated 9 years ago
- An elegant armor-plated JavaScript lexer modelled after flex. Easily extensible to tailor to your need for perfection.β410Jun 8, 2018Updated 7 years ago
- A library and language for building parsers, interpreters, compilers, etc.β5,486Mar 17, 2026Updated last week
- PEG.js: Parser generator for JavaScriptβ4,913Nov 8, 2021Updated 4 years ago
- A monadic LL(infinity) parser combinator library for javascriptβ1,267Apr 14, 2023Updated 2 years ago
- Opposite of a parser: generates minimum-length derivation from a parse tree.β17Oct 16, 2017Updated 8 years ago
- Everyday programming for ordinary people. Pre-pre-alpha.β10Dec 16, 2017Updated 8 years ago
- text-based Scratch project editor, Take Two.β80Dec 29, 2022Updated 3 years ago
- A robust and light-weight path-to-regexp alternativeβ19Dec 25, 2021Updated 4 years ago
- NES emulator on MIT Scratch, rewrite using metaprogrammingβ10Jan 23, 2017Updated 9 years ago
- Compiles a grammar from a nearley grammar file.β14Jul 20, 2020Updated 5 years ago
- String Tokenization Library for JavaScriptβ110Nov 20, 2025Updated 4 months ago
- A 100% compliant, self-hosted javascript parser - https://meriyah.github.io/meriyahβ1,189Mar 1, 2026Updated 3 weeks ago
- Peggy: Parser generator for JavaScriptβ1,159Mar 1, 2026Updated 3 weeks ago
- Nearley Language Support for Visual Studio Codeβ26Dec 30, 2021Updated 4 years ago
- Super-fast alternative to Babel for when you can target modern JS runtimesβ5,859Nov 19, 2025Updated 4 months ago
- π³ Tiny and fast JavaScript code generator from an ESTree-compliant AST.β1,241Dec 1, 2024Updated last year
- Incremental parsing systemβ687Jan 25, 2026Updated last month
- It's the world according to Brian Harvey (and also Jens MΓΆnig).β10Feb 25, 2016Updated 10 years ago
- Bison in JavaScript.β4,387Oct 14, 2022Updated 3 years ago
- JavaScript parser-combinator libraryβ315Nov 5, 2025Updated 4 months ago
- Manipulate strings like a wizardβ2,670Oct 24, 2025Updated 5 months ago
- TypeScript Compiler API wrapper for static analysis and programmatic code changes.β5,983Oct 12, 2025Updated 5 months ago
- π¦ Zero-configuration bundler for tiny modules.β8,142Feb 1, 2026Updated last month
- output coverage reports using Node.js' built in coverageβ2,095Updated this week
- A small, fast, JavaScript-based JavaScript parserβ11,347Mar 14, 2026Updated last week
- JavaScript syntax tree transformer, nondestructive pretty-printer, and automatic source map generatorβ5,229Mar 3, 2025Updated last year
- Code powering an unofficial search engine for MIT's Scratch forums. Currently in beta!β10Jan 28, 2016Updated 10 years ago
- A Python module for bridging Scratch and Pythonβ14Apr 2, 2017Updated 8 years ago
- Rust-based platform for the Webβ33,314Updated this week
- Nustack is a stack-oriented concatenative programming language with support for high-level modular programming and Python integration.β13Mar 16, 2016Updated 10 years ago
- Process execution for humansβ7,469Jan 29, 2026Updated last month
- Validation and parsing for Scratch projectsβ70Mar 13, 2026Updated last week
- Simple reverse mode automatic differentiation of scalar values in javascriptβ19May 1, 2025Updated 10 months ago
- Parse, inspect, transform, and serialize content with syntax treesβ4,945Feb 4, 2025Updated last year
- Open source messaging platform for the modern webβ21Mar 11, 2021Updated 5 years ago